能不能给我讲讲Java的逻辑?
发布网友
发布时间:2022-07-31 08:08
我来回答
共3个回答
热心网友
时间:2024-11-24 07:31
要玩JAVA,首先要明白,JAVA程序是通过JAVA虚拟机来执行的。
然后就是变量,简单变量包括整形,字符串,时间等等,复杂变量就是类,类是啥,就是现实世界中的一个名词类型,如“车”就是个类,我买了一个车,那我买的这个车就是“车”这个类的一个实例。注意:JAVA变量里变量是要申明才能用的。
内存空间不用考虑,JAVA里有个东西叫GC,会自动回收。
编程的细节,推荐你看《JAVA编程思想》这本书。
可以跟我探讨。追问谢谢你,我再琢磨一下
你对于实例的解说真棒
热心网友
时间:2024-11-24 07:32
要下班了,另你想的太复杂了,java很简单,this代表当前对象就是你在用的。getXX肯定有getxx()方法,如果你没有看到代码里有写,那就是父类里面的。“变量直接调用”,写在前面,后面是没有关系的,一般写在前面 。
class A{
private String name;
public void printName(){
System.out.println(name);
}
}
这个name属性可以写在printName()的前面后面,都一样。
这个里面 name叫属性 printName()叫方法
如果 有A a=new A(); 那么a是A的实例
等等
热心网友
时间:2024-11-24 07:32
我觉得你应该先去理解java的面向对象思想,你觉得诡异应该是以前接触的都是面向过程的语言吧?